Mainstream media misreports that Sakhsi Malik withdraws from wrestlers protest.

Claim

Sakshi Malik withdraws from wrestlers’ protest, joins back railway job

The wrestlers are protesting for a long time now demanding the arrest of BJP MLA and Wrestling Federation of India (WFI) Chief Brij Bhushan Charan Singh over sexual harassment case. The Delhi police has registered 2 FIRs so far against him including a complaint from a minor wrestler invoking POSCO Act after protesting. But no other action was taken against him so far. He denied all the charges and said he will hang himself if any of the allegations against him are proven.

Meanwhile, mainstream media including India Today, and BJP supporters and social media users claim that Sakshee Malikkh and Bajrang Punia have withdrawn from the protest and have joined their work with the Railways. Some of the posts with such a claim can be seen here and here.

What is the truth?

When searching the Twitter page of Sakshee Malikkh, we found that the claim that they have withdrawn from the wrestlers’ protest is fake. Her tweet dated 5, June 2023 is found carrying Aaj Tak breaking news card that conveyed “Wrestler Sakshi withdraws from the protest and joined Railways job after withdrawing from the protest”, which she denies.

The caption in Hindi denies the claim and is roughly translated as “This news is completely wrong. In the fight for justice, none of us has backed down, nor will we. Along with Satyagraha, I am fulfilling my responsibility in Railways. Our fight continues till justice is served. Please don’t spread any wrong news.”

Bajrang Punia’s tweet dated 5, June 2023 mentions that the news of withdrawing the movement is just a rumour. He further mentioned that these news are being spread to harm them. It is also mentioned, “We have neither retreated nor have we withdrawn the movement. The news of women wrestlers raising FIR is also false. The fight will continue till justice is served.”

When searching to know if the wrestlers have rejoined their work in Railways, we found The Tribune article that reported that they joined their work last week and met Amit Shah on 3, June 2023, late Saturday evening. The article mentions that wrestlers Sakshi Malik, Bajrang Punia and Vinesh Phogat have resumed their duties in the Railways, a spokesman of the Northern Railways has confirmed.

Conclusion

It is found that none of the wrestlers have withdrawn from the protest as reported by India Today or as amplified by BJP supporters. The wrestlers’ tweets confirm that they are still protesting.

It is to be noted that they resumed their work with the Northern Railways last week. And they met Amit Shah two days back.
